> Plans are being made to be at Amelia Island and Sebring 12 Hour in March
> 2017.
>
> The plan so far is to have the:
>
> 57 Sebring TR3 from the UK
> 63 Sebring TR4 from the UK
> TR250K that ran in the late 60s
> Bob Kramer's Sebring TR4
>
> Russ Pierce plans to bring the Macau.
>
> HSR is the sanctioning body and will have the schedule and entry
> information.
>
> Lodging is an issue and should be pursued early on.
>
> (I plan to stay at the track)
>
> There are no designated project people leading the charge on this.
> Hopefully, the FOT attending will share information and provide support to
> each other.
>
> It is quite possible that the original drivers will attend along with Kas
> and Peg. I am hoping that the current car owners will extend those
> invitations to Bob Tullius, Ed Diehl, and Bob Johns.
>
> I AM looking for a means to get Kas & Peg there and to secure lodging. Any
> ideas are welcome.
>
> Potentially, this could be one of the most significant Triumph Vintage
> Reunions of current times. Tim Suddard called. I know he is interested in
> covering it. Burt Levy is also interested.
>
> And then there is the Kastner Cup in June. The U.K. Triumphs will be
> shipped there to Black Hawk Farms to run the Kastner Cup. How cool is that?
>
> Anyway, I hope the Amelia and Sebring events gain great traction. I
> suspect that it will. There is no doubt that the 15th Running of the
> Kastner Cup will be huge. (Hosted by Brian Garcia and Jason Ostrowski.)
